Purdue Northwest Pride, featuring former Yorkville Christian High School star Cody Hazzard, were defeated 7-5 by the Kentucky Wesleyan Panthers in their NCAA Division II baseball game at noon Sunday, March 1.

Panther Park served as the venue for the game, which marked the fourth time the Pride faced the Panthers this season. In their previous meeting on Saturday, Feb. 28, the Pride lost 9-1.

Hazzard pitched two innings, allowing six earned runs with two walks and two strikeouts.

The Pride are set to play their next game against the Lewis Flyers at Dowling Park on Friday, March 6, at 1 p.m.

Cody Hazzard — Pitcher — Junior — 6′2″ — 210 — Hometown: Mazon
